Output e85d3ab5b5732dc54f83dcbf91835b424c8524df0a35409c41b1cc36b0817f05:0

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d768375f665f1b89b2183ceff24fbb61cc4a8ad OP_EQUAL
address
3JxocGE969gtGsgfsokHZy4tcaNbuxDvnS
transaction
e85d3ab5b5732dc54f83dcbf91835b424c8524df0a35409c41b1cc36b0817f05
spent
true